Climate Climate Climate: Long term weather patterns of an area Patterns used to describe climate Annual variation of temperature Precipitation Wind Other weather variables Causes of Climate 1. Latitude: Areas of different latitude receive different amounts of solar radiation Example: tropics vs the poles 2. Topographic effects: water heats up and cools down more slowly than land As altitude increase temperature decreases Mountains have different climates from one side to another Causes of Climate 3. Air Masses: two of the main causes of weather are the movement and interaction of Air masses The location of where the air mass forms impacts the areas climate Rain Shadow The incoming warm and moist air is drawn towards the top of the mountain, where it condenses and precipitates before it crosses the top. The air, without much moisture left, advances behind the mountains creating a drier side called the "rain shadow". Source Regions Over warm area: the warm area makes the air above warm. Over water: water evaporates into the air above and makes it moist. Polar: (P) cold (poles) Mr. Fetch’s Earth Science Classroom Air masses move by prevailing winds. The winds cause the air masses to move over land and water. As the air masses move, they change. This is called air mass modification. The air masses becomes more like the area it is moving over and at the same time, the area the air mass is moving over becomes more like the mass.
